can someone please explain what the nut & grub screw is for that is in the center of the outer clutch plate ie the plate that has the springs in it thanks.

Hi Derek,

My guess is that as the clutch push-rod rotates when the bike is running, the back of the grub screw will be case hardened in order to minimize wear.  So basically it's to prevent the centre of the outer pressure plate from wearing through.
